Beşiktaş has been representing Türkiye in European cups since 1959. The club will face a Lithuanian representative for the first time in its history.
Beşiktaş will face Lithuanian team Kauno Zalgiris at Tüpraş Stadium in the first match of the UEFA Europa League play-off round tomorrow at 20.00. Kartal wants to have an advantage in the away match without losing at home.
Black Eagles will have their 263rd appointment in European cups with the Kauno Zalgiris match.
The black-and-white football team won 101 of 262 matches in European cups, drew 50, and lost to its rivals in 111 matches.
Beşiktaş, which scored 353 goals in the European arena, conceded 395 goals.
The black-whites represented Türkiye abroad 47 times, including the qualifying rounds, in the European cup adventure that started in 1959.
Beşiktaş took part in the European Champion Clubs' Cup and UEFA Champions League 19 times, the European Cup Winners' Cup 7 times, the UEFA Cup and UEFA Europa League 19 times and the UEFA Conference League 2 times.
FIRST APPOINTMENT WITH LITHUANIA REPRESENTATIVES
Beşiktaş, which has left 262 matches in European cups behind, will face a Lithuanian team for the first time.
The match between the black and whites and Kauno Zalgiris will go down in club history in this sense.
138TH MATCH IN CUP 2
Beşiktaş has previously played 137 matches in the "number 2" organization of European football at the club level.
Beşiktaş achieved 61 wins in the organization, which started to be organized under the name of the Fair Cities Cup in 1955, became the UEFA Cup since the 1971-1972 season, and has been organized under the name of the UEFA Europa League since 2009-2010.
The black-whites drew 25 times with their opponents and lost 51 matches.
Beşiktaş scored 214 goals in the "Cup 2" matches and conceded 180 goals.
The black-whites will play their 138th match in this organization against Kauno Zalgiris.
132nd HOME MATCH
The black-whites will play their 132nd home game against Kauno Zalgiris.
Beşiktaş has previously appeared in 131 matches as the host in European cups. The black-whites won 66 of these matches, drew 26 and lost 39 of them.
Beşiktaş, which scored 202 times in the opponent's net, conceded 150 goals.
3 MATCHES THAT CANNOT BE PLAYED IN ISTANBUL
The black-white team had to play 3 of their home matches outside Istanbul in the European cups.
In the 1986-1987 season, Beşiktaş played the match against the Ukrainian representative Dinamo Kiev in the quarter-finals of the Champion Clubs' Cup, which was supposed to be held in Istanbul, in Izmir due to weather conditions. The black-whites lost 5-0 to their opponent in this match.
Due to the terrorist bomb attack in Istanbul, Beşiktaş played a home match in Germany. The black-white team, which took part in the Champions League in 2003-2004, faced Chelsea in Gelsenkirchen and lost 2-0.
In another match where they had to play at home, Beşiktaş faced the Israeli team Maccabi Tel Aviv in Hungary in the 2024-2025 season. According to the statement of the black-and-white club, it was decided that the match in question would be played in a neutral country, "taking into account the possibility of provocative action". In the match at Nagyerdei Stadium, Beşiktaş lost 3-1.
PLAYED IN THE QUARTER FINALS 3 TIMES IN EUROPE
Beşiktaş succeeded in reaching the quarter-finals 3 times in European cups.
The black-whites, who made it to the quarter-finals of the European Champion Clubs' Cup in the 1986-1987 season, were among the last 8 teams in the UEFA Cup in 2002-2003.
While Beşiktaş reached the quarter-finals of the UEFA Europa League in the 2016-2017 season, they were eliminated by Olimpik Lyon as a result of penalties in this round and bid farewell to the organization.
THE MOST DIFFERENT WIN WAS AGAINST B36 TORSHAVN
Beşiktaş had its biggest victory in European cups against Faroe Islands team B36 Torshavn.
The black-white team managed to beat B36 Torshavn 6-0 at home in the 2nd qualifying round of the UEFA Europa League in the 2018-2019 season.
In the 2002-2003 season, Beşiktaş was the guest of Sarajevo, the representative of Bosnia and Herzegovina, in the UEFA Cup 1st round rematch and won 5-0.
The black-whites also defeated Israel's Maccabi Tel Aviv and Switzerland's Lugano team with scores of 5-1 in the UEFA Europa League.

THE MOST DIFFERENT DEFEATS
Beşiktaş suffered the defeat with the most different scores in the history of European cups from the English representative Liverpool.
In the 2007-2008 season, the Black-Whites lost to Liverpool away with a score of 8-0 in the UEFA Champions League Group A match.
Beşiktaş lost to the English team Leeds United away in the UEFA Champions League Group H in the 2000-2001 season, and to the Ukrainian representative Dynamo Kiev in the same organization in the 2016-2017 season with a score of 6-0.
EUROPEAN GOALSATORS
Beşiktaş's top scorer in European cups has been Oktay Derelioğlu for nearly 30 years.
Oktay Derelioğlu, who scored 14 goals in Europe between 1993 and 1999 with the black and white jersey, is in the first place, followed by Vincent Aboubakar and Cenk Tosun, who scored 13 times each. Beşiktaş's Ricardo Quaresma and Bobo scored 12 goals each in Europe.
Among the players in Beşiktaş's current squad, Milot Rashica has 4 goals, Semih Kılıçsoy has 3 goals, captain Orkun Kökçü has 2 goals and Vaclav Cerny has 1 goal.
